Web30 de mar. de 2024 · The Asian giant hornet has reached fame thanks to its nickname online, the “murder hornet.”. While the species stings can be quite painful, it’s estimated the hornets kill less than 40 people a year in countries across Asia. For perspective, 89 people in the U.S. died in 2024 from native hornets, wasps, and bees, per the CDC.
